Home Forums SQL Server 2005 Administering SNAPSHOT Isolation with (NOLOCK) being used all over RE: SNAPSHOT Isolation with (NOLOCK) being used all over

  • Thanks for the confirmation on this Gail. Is there any good reason you can think of to always be using the WITH(NOLOCK) hint in all queries? This is not a financial institute I am working with, but they do have some financial record keeping in the various databases, along with time critical items from auction bidding. Wouldn't the WITH(NOLOCK) defeat the whole purpose of discouraging against dirty reads? Or is it such a performance increase that it's worth it to be used indiscriminately? I've read that DEVS will use it to get around back database design on long running queries, but it just seems to me to be a lot like addressing symptoms instead of addressing the real issue of database design.